Fix upload errors with feeds in business data

If your data set or feed isn't formatted right, this can prevent your ads from showing. 

Before you begin

Pay close attention to the required feed attributes. The system disapproves inaccurate or incomplete feeds after 30 days. Make sure that your data complies with Google’s advertising policies and any relevant laws in your targeted locations.

This article explains how to find out why your data set or feed has errors and how to fix them.

Instructions

Note: The instructions below are part of the new design for the Google Ads user experience. To use the previous design, click the 'Appearance' icon, and select Use previous design. If you're using the previous version of Google Ads, review the Quick reference map or use the Search bar in the top navigation panel of Google Ads to find the page that you’re searching for.
  1. In your Google Ads account, click the Tools icon Tools Icon.
  2. Click Business data.
  3. Click the name of the data feed that you'd like to review.
  4. Locate the error messages for your business data feed:
    1. Data tab: As soon as you upload, you might see a Disapproved status and a message describing something that's wrong.
    2. "Summary" column in your "Upload history" tab: Errors here show how you should change the format of your uploaded spreadsheet.
    3. "Details" section in your "Summary" column: Errors here show how you should change the format or content of the rows within your spreadsheet. Want to download a spreadsheet with all of these row-level errors? Click the Download errors button under "ACTIONS".
  5. Use the upload error table below to fix the issue based on the error message.
  6. You may need to add or update your feed with corrected data. Learn more about how to Keep your business data updated.

Fix upload errors

When your data set or feed isn't formatted correctly, it can prevent your ads from showing. Google Ads shows errors that can help you fix your spreadsheet in a few places:

  • In the upload panel: As soon as you upload, you might see text in red describing something that's wrong.
  • Under 'Summary' in your 'Upload history' table: Errors here show how you should change the format of your uploaded spreadsheet.
  • In the 'Details' under 'Summary' in your 'Upload history' table: Errors here show how you should change the format or content of the rows within your spreadsheet. Want to download a spreadsheet with all of these row-level errors? Click the Download errors button under 'ACTIONS'.

Bear in mind

  • Feeds should not be scheduled to end at midnight.
  • Scheduled uploads will only work at 15-minute increments (0, 15, 30, 45).
Fix upload errors
Error message Issue How to fix it
An ID value is not allowed when using the action 'Add' You provided an 'item ID' for a row that you're trying to add. New rows shouldn't have item IDs because these are added by Google Ads. Edit your file, remove the ID value for the row that you're trying to add and re-upload.
Image not available Google Ads can't access the image. For example, the server hosting the image may be blocking access or taking too long to allow access. Host the image in an accessible location.
Incorrect format for field The value in the scheduling column is invalid. Scheduled uploads will only work at 15-minute increments (0, 15, 30, 45).
Invalid image format The image isn't a standard file type or format. Convert the image to .PNG, .JPG, .JPEG, .GIF and save it in RGB colour code with an ICC profile attached.
Invalid image size The image is too large. Reduce the image:

- Recommended image size: 300px by 300px
- Recommended resolution: 72dpi
- Maximum file size: 6MB
Invalid address format The address isn't formatted correctly. Use one of these formatting methods:

- City, state code, country
- Full address with postcode
- Latitude-longitude in the DDD format

Use commas to separate your address. See the specs for cities, regions and countries.
Invalid [attribute name]: [error] The type of data that you've entered for a custom attribute doesn't match the attribute type that you've chosen. Make sure that your data are in the right format for the attribute type you've specified. For dates, remember that 00:00:00 signifies midnight (not 24:00:00).
See attribute types
Invalid URL The URL that you provided in the 'Final URL' field is not a valid URL and will need to be addressed.
  • Make sure that there are no special characters present in the URL. All special characters will need to be encoded.
  • Make sure that the URL leads to a functioning URL.
  • The final URL should not exceed 2,048 characters.
It looks like you've added new attributes. You'll need to add these attributes to your existing data set or feed before you can bulk-edit them. Your file has columns that Google Ads doesn't recognise. Remove the problem columns and try again, or add the new columns before bulk-editing them.
New data sets or feeds can't include an 'Action' column (the 'Action' column is for bulk-editing existing data sets or feeds). Please remove that column and try again. The file that you're uploading includes an 'Action' column. Remove the 'Action' column and try again.
No item matching item ID. Your file includes a row with an 'item ID' that Google Ads doesn't recognise. Google Ads defines these values. Find your item IDs: click 'Columns', then 'Attributes' and 'Item ID' to add that column to the table. Use these IDs when you're bulk-editing the values of your feed or data set.
One of the rows that you're trying to edit doesn't exist in your current business data set. If you'd like to add a new row, make sure that you choose the 'Update' option and put 'add' in the 'Action' column. Your file includes a row with an ID that Google Ads doesn't recognise. Either correct the ID value or, if you're adding a new row, change the action to 'Add'.
One or more columns you've defined has an unrecognised type. Google Ads recognises these types: (text), (number), (price), (date). One or more of your custom columns is missing a valid attribute type. Define a text, number, price or date attribute type for each of your custom columns.
See the specs for attribute types
Please use either a 'target keyword' column or both 'target keyword text' and 'target keyword match type' columns. All three cannot be used in a single row. You're using too many keyword targeting columns. Use either:

- A 'target keyword' column
- A 'target keyword text' column with a 'target keyword match type' column.

See all targeting attributes
Schedule end not after start Start time comes after end time. Feeds should not be scheduled to end at midnight.
Set or Remove actions requires the 'Item ID' column. Google Ads can't tell which rows you want to update. Include an ID column in the file that you're using to update your data set or feed.
To find the IDs that Google Ads has assigned, click 'Columns', choose 'Attributes', then 'Item ID'.
Target ad group not found. Google Ads can't find the 'target ad group' that you've specified. Make sure that you match the name of an existing ad group exactly, including spaces and capitalisation.
Target campaign not found. Google Ads can't find the 'target campaign' that you've specified. Make sure that you match the name of an existing campaign exactly, including spaces and capitalisation.
'Target campaign' is required when setting 'target ad group'. The 'target campaign' column is missing. You need this column when you're using the 'target ad group' column. Add a 'target campaign' column.
See all targeting attributes
'Target keyword match type' is required when using 'target keyword text'. The 'target keyword match type' column is missing. You need this column when you're using the 'target keyword text' column. Add a 'target keyword match type' column.
See all targeting attributes
The 'Custom ID' column needs to be named 'Custom ID', with no attribute type, like '(number)' or '(text)', specified. Remove the type, save your file again and re-upload. See attribute guidelines You've included an attribute type with your 'Custom ID' column, but this shouldn't include an attribute type. Remove the attribute type next to the column that you've named 'Custom ID'.
This item already exists. The file that you're using to update your feed or data set says to 'add' a row that already exists. Use a new 'custom ID', or don't specify an ID, for rows you're adding.
Value is incompatible with the attribute's type in column 'X', e.g. the type 'number' is incompatible with any values that have letters or symbols. A row in your file includes data that are in the wrong format for the attribute you've specified. Format your data according to the attribute type you've chosen. See standard attribute formats
You already have a data set or feed with this name. Please enter a new name. You already have a data set or feed with this name. Use a new name for each of your new data sets or feeds.
Your data set or feed wasn't updated because the spreadsheet you're trying to upload includes an 'Action' column. Choose 'Update' (not 'Replace') if you'd like to include an 'Action' column, or remove your 'Action' column and try again. Your file contains an 'Action' column. The 'Action' column is only for updating your data, but you chose 'Replace'. Remove the 'Action' column and try again.
You've reached the limit of business data sets that you can have (100 sets). You'll need to remove one before you can add a new one. Your account has too many data sets. Remove a data set that you're not using in order to add a new one. Be careful not to remove extension feeds (like 'Main sitelink feed') if you want to keep those extensions.

Was this helpful?

How can we improve it?
Search
Clear search
Close search
Main menu
10403225860843482494
true
Search Help Centre
true
true
true
true
true
73067
false
false
false